Main module, this implements the Liskov Rivest Wagner block cipher mode
in the new blockcipher API. The implementation is based on ecb.c.The LRW-32-AES specification I used can be found at:
http://grouper.ieee.org/groups/1619/email/pdf00017.pdfIt implements the optimization specified as optional in the
specification, and in addition it uses optimized multiplication
routines from gf128mul.c.Since gf128mul.[ch] is not tested on bigendian, this cipher mode
may currently fail badly on bigendian machines.Signed-off-by: Rik Snel
